walangkaji / zte-f670-api
此包已被弃用且不再维护。未建议替代包。
ZTE F670 非官方 API
v1.1
2020-05-04 14:04 UTC
Requires
This package is auto-updated.
Last update: 2023-02-21 01:48:55 UTC
README
警告 我们已决定停止维护此包。
考虑迁移到 ZteF。
请随意分支我们的代码并按需修改。
ZTE F670 非官方 API
此库是 Emboh. TITIK
支持我
Paypal: Se-Ikhlasnya Saja
安装
Composer
$ composer require walangkaji/zte-f670-api
克隆
$ git clone https://github.com/walangkaji/zte-f670-api.git
$ cd zte-f670-api/
$ composer install
使用方法
require 'vendor/autoload.php'; use walangkaji\ZteF670\ZteF670; $ipModem = '192.168.1.1'; $username = 'admin'; $password = 'password'; $debug = false; $zteF670 = new ZteF670($ipModem, $username, $password, $debug); $login = $zteF670->login(); var_dump($login); // Terusno dewe
如果需要使用代理
$ipModem = '192.168.1.1'; $username = 'admin'; $password = 'password'; $debug = false; $proxy = 'xxx.xxx.xxx.xxx:xxxx' $zteF670 = new ZteF670($ipModem, $username, $password, $debug, $proxy); $login = $zteF670->login(); var_dump($login); // Terusno dewe
重启/重启调制解调器的示例
$zteF670 = new ZteF670($ipModem, $username, $password); $login = $zteF670->login(); if (!$login) { echo 'Login gagal' . PHP_EOL; exit(); } $reboot = $zteF670->reboot(); if ($reboot) { echo 'Berhasil reboot modem.' . PHP_EOL; }
获取设备信息的示例
$zteF670 = new ZteF670($ipModem, $username, $password); $login = $zteF670->login(); $info = $zteF670->status->deviceInformation(); var_dump($info);
获取 PON 信息的示例
$zteF670 = new ZteF670($ipModem, $username, $password); $login = $zteF670->login(); $info = $zteF670->status->NetworkInterface->ponInformation(); var_dump($info);
可用方法
$zteF670->login(); $zteF670->reboot(); $zteF670->status->deviceInformation(); $zteF670->status->voIpStatus(); $zteF670->status->NetworkInterface->wanConnection(); $zteF670->status->NetworkInterface->wanConnection3Gor4G(); $zteF670->status->NetworkInterface->tunnelConnection4in6(); $zteF670->status->NetworkInterface->tunnelConnection6in4(); $zteF670->status->NetworkInterface->ponInformation(); $zteF670->status->NetworkInterface->mobileNetwork(); $zteF670->status->UserInterface->wlan(); $zteF670->status->UserInterface->ethernet(); $zteF670->status->UserInterface->usb();
待办事项
还有很多功能可以添加。以后会一边流泪一边工作。本质上这是由于需求而制作的。如果需要,请随意添加。如果愿意添加,将非常欢迎。
就到这里,再见。
如果想要真正支持,可以通过这里
Paypal: Se-Ikhlasnya Saja